Zara, a Spanish clothing and accessories retailer, has become a global fashion powerhouse. Known for its unique business model, Zara epitomizes the concept of fast fashion. With its beginnings in the textile industry in 1974, Zara has risen to become one of the world's largest and most successful fashion retailers. The brand's unique approach to design, production, and distribution sets it apart in the industry. Zara's distinctive approach to fashion is characterized by its ability to quickly respond to changing trends. Unlike traditional fashion retailers that plan their collections months in advance, Zara operates on a "fast fashion" model. It designs, manufactures, and delivers new products to stores within a matter of weeks. This allows the brand to stay at the forefront of current fashion trends and adapt to consumer preferences in real-time.
